This subclass just got out of my head, and I think I've got something nice. With WotC experimenting with the Mystic, I thought it might be fun to have a psionics flavored rogue, considering we already have the Arcane Trickster. Just so people aren't confused, I didn't use actual psionics for this for two reasons. The first, I didn't want to step on the toes of the Mystic too much, which, I know, is fairly hard to do. The second, the psionics system is still rather fluid and subject to change, that, in combination with the fact that it's a system that is possibly even more complex than magic, meant I didn't want to be rebuilding this subclass from the ground up if and when (more likely when) they finally revise the mystic. Plus I did't want to figure out how to distribute psi points for stuff, so...

I like what I have here, and I like the concept of the Mindwalker manipulating targets by literally getting inside their heads. I realize some of you are going to be confused why Unwitting Drone has a farther range than Telepathy, but this is mainly a scouting mechanic/safe exploration mechanic when combined with Little Voice. It's going to be difficult to see through someone you've infiltrated and stay within 60ft of them without getting spotted, especially considering your not aware of your own surroundings while you're using it.
